No painter license, but WSIB is mandatory
Ontario does not license painters provincially, so anyone can print business cards. But WSIB workplace-injury coverage is compulsory for construction work in Ontario, and residential painting counts. If an uninsured worker gets hurt on your Toronto property, you can be held personally liable for their medical costs and lost wages. So ask any painter for a current WSIB clearance certificate and two million dollars of liability coverage.
Cabbagetown permits painting over brick
Cabbagetown is blanketed by five Heritage Conservation Districts under the Ontario Heritage Act, the most protected neighbourhood in Toronto. Repainting an already-painted surface is routine, but painting over brick falls outside the exemption and needs a heritage permit from the city. So if you own a Cabbagetown Victorian with bare brick, you cannot simply coat it. Heritage Preservation Services reviews that change first.
Canada has no EPA lead rule
Canada never adopted the American EPA RRP rule, so no federal lead-safe certification governs your Toronto renovation. Canada capped lead in consumer paint at 5,000 parts per million in 1976 and tightened it to 90 in 2005, which means the Victorian and Edwardian homes across the Annex and Cabbagetown still hide old lead layers. So follow Health Canada's lead-safe practices when you sand old paint.
Freeze and thaw pops paint off brick
Toronto's freeze and thaw cycles are brutal on exterior paint. Coatings need a surface temperature of at least 10C to cure, yet Toronto winters sit between minus 5 and minus 15C for weeks. Moisture trapped behind paint on brick freezes, expands, and pops the film right off the wall. So exterior painting here is strictly a warm-season job, never a mild-January gamble.
Your painting season is two months
Toronto gives you a shockingly short exterior painting season. The dependable windows are really just mid-May through June and a brief stretch in September, when daytime temperatures hold in the 15 to 22C range and overnight lows stay above 10C. Lake Ontario piles humidity and wind on top. So miss those weeks and your repaint waits until next year.
The First Painter to Call Back Books the Estimate
Reach a lead within five minutes instead of thirty and you are far likelier to connect and qualify the homeowner. For a repaint, the painter who answers first usually gets the walkthrough and the job. So more traffic will not fix a slow phone. A faster first response will.
Consent Has To Be Meaningful
In Ontario your site runs under PIPEDA, the federal privacy law. And PIPEDA does not accept buried consent. The Privacy Commissioner says you have to spotlight the key points, what you collect, why, who you share it with, and the risk of harm, in language a reasonable person actually understands. So your quote form needs a plain, up-front explanation, not a wall of legal text nobody reads before they hit submit.
A Leak Triggers A Report
PIPEDA has had mandatory breach reporting since November 2018. So if a break-in at your data creates a real risk of significant harm, you have to tell the Privacy Commissioner and the affected people as soon as feasible. And you must keep a record of every breach for two years, even the small ones. So a leaky form or a hacked CRM is not a quiet problem, it is a reporting duty.
